proxyscrape 项目常见问题解决方案
1. 项目基础介绍与主要编程语言
proxyscrape
是一个开源的 Python 库,主要用于从网络中检索免费的代理(HTTP、HTTPS、SOCKS4 和 SOCKS5)。这个库支持 Python 2.7+ 和 Python 3.4+。它的主要用途是提供一种高效且简单的方式来获取代理,通常用于网页抓取等开发或测试目的。需要注意的是,这个库并不是为生产环境设计的,建议使用自己的代理或购买提供 API 的服务。
主要编程语言:Python
2. 新手在使用这个项目时需要特别注意的问题及解决步骤
问题一:如何安装 proxyscrape 库?
解决步骤:
- 确保你的系统中已经安装了 Python。
- 打开命令行工具(如终端或命令提示符)。
- 执行以下命令安装 proxyscrape:
pip install proxyscrape
问题二:如何创建一个 HTTP 代理收集器并获取一个代理?
解决步骤:
- 在你的 Python 脚本中导入
proxyscrape
模块。import proxyscrape
- 创建一个 HTTP 代理收集器。
collector = proxyscrape.create_collector('default', 'http')
- 使用收集器获取一个代理。
proxy = collector.get_proxy(['country': 'united states'])
问题三:proxyscrape 提供的代理是否适用于所有场景?
解决步骤:
- 了解
proxyscrape
提供的代理是从各种免费代理网站上抓取的,可能不稳定。 - 识别你的使用场景。如果是非生产环境的开发或测试,可以使用这些代理。
- 如果在生产环境中使用,建议使用自己的代理或者购买专业的代理服务,以确保稳定性和安全性。
请注意,proxyscrape
的代理不适用于需要高稳定性或安全性的场景,仅建议用于开发或测试目的。
创作声明:本文部分内容由AI辅助生成(AIGC),仅供参考